Side-by-Side Comparison
| Feature | llegaré | llévame |
|---|---|---|
| Definition | Primera persona del singular (yo) del futuro de indicativo de llegar o de llegarse. | Segunda persona del singular (tú) del imperativo afirmativo de llevar (con el pronombre «me» enclítico); solicitud para que mi interlocutor me lleve a mí o lleve algo para mí. |

Spelling & Dictionary Insight
A purely visual mix-up. llegaré ([ʝeɣ̞aˈɾe]) and llévame ([ˈʝeβ̞ame])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they share most of their letters but differ in 4 positions.
